This is the first book I have read by this author, and even though I got the feeling there are other novels relating back to this one, I didn’t feel left out. It was enough to intrigue me to want to hunt them down and check them out. And if this is the case, those that have read the previous books, know that Emmett and Aly held their own, their story is one you’ll not want to miss.
Emmett gives off the impression that he is a hard nosed playboy but it’s not a life style he is happy about. There is a girl that he holds dear to his heart but she won’t have a bar of him. Aly won’t forgive him for all the dirty tricks he played on her in high school. She has spent her life trying to make her father proud, even buying the family business and making it thrive again. When these two meet up after 12 years, it is anything but platonic.
When I started reading, it had a sense of familiarity about this story. Whether it was due to it being a friends to lovers romance that I enjoy or the dual POV, it just felt right diving in and falling for both Aly and Emmett. He was a dependable character full of family loyalty. I loved his cheeky playful side when interacting with Aly. She had me giggling with her stumbling reactions when confronted with Emmett head on! She may have been stubborn, but she too was loyal to her family but more to her friends that had become her family. The secrets that they are keeping might come back to haunt them, but their similar personalities will help them to understand each other’s decisions to reach their HEA.

This is the story of Aly Stanton and Emmett Hoult.
These two have known each other since birth and went to the same schools right up until junior year in high school. Aly’s view of how those years went down are the complete opposite of how Emmett sees them.
In her eyes, she was emotionally tortured and bullied by him, but in Emmett’s version of events he only teased her, and at weekends, they were best of friends.
Aly’s problems, growing up and as an adult stemmed from more than one outlet. It was heartbreaking to see her treated so callously by the one person she should have had unconditional love from.
Aly hasn’t seen Emmett for 12 years, she missed a lot of his life, not all of it good or nice when she cut him out of her life after a major incident in junior year. One she swore never to forgive him for.
When a fire destroys her apartment and she need somewhere to live for the summer, she is offered Emmett’s summerhome in the Hampton’s where her new restaurant is located. She agrees when she hears Emmett is away for the whole summer. Or so everyone thinks.
Things get complicated when one night she goes home with a guy she met at a nightclub and they roll up to his home ... the home she’s staying in for the summer. Imagine her surprise to find out that the hot guy she thought she was hooking up with was Emmett.
I loved the interaction between this couple. There are miscommunications, some super hot steamy scenes and of course one last secret that threatens to come between them.
I loved the secondary characters of Drew (he’s Emmett’s mate and a pretty terrible wingman but he’s hilariously fun) and Aly’s bestie Evie who despite her own life going sideways always gives the best advice!
This is one book I couldn’t put down!
